    What is Cervical Stenosis?
    Cervical stenosis is a condition where the opening of the cervix, known as the cervical os, becomes narrow or partially closed. This can be caused by a variety of factors such as scarring from previous surgeries or procedures, abnormal growths, or a congenital abnormality. Cervical stenosis can also occur as a result of aging, as the cervix naturally becomes narrower and less flexible with age.

    What is Intra Cervical Insemination?

    Before we dive into the impact of medical conditions on ICI success rates, let’s first understand what ICI is and how it works. ICI is a form of artificial insemination that involves placing washed and prepared sperm directly into the cervix using a catheter. This method is less invasive and less expensive than other fertility treatments such as in vitro fertilization (IVF). ICI is often recommended for couples with unexplained infertility, mild male factor infertility, or single women who want to conceive using donor sperm.

    6. Polycystic Ovarian Syndrome (PCOS)

    Polycystic Ovarian Syndrome (PCOS) is a hormonal disorder that affects women of reproductive age. This condition can cause irregular ovulation or anovulation, making it difficult for the sperm to fertilize an egg.
